Cisco IOS Software for Cisco Integrated Services Routers Denial-of-Service Vulnerability

Cisco - IOS software · Listed in the CISA KEV since 2022-03-03. This indicates confirmed attacks in production environments.

Required action: Apply updates per vendor instructions.

Summary

A vulnerability in the implementation of a protocol in Cisco Integrated Services Routers Generation 2 (ISR G2) Routers running Cisco IOS 15.0 through 15.6 allows an unauthenticated, adjacent attacker to cause an affected device to reload, resulting in a denial of service (DoS). It is due to misclassification of Ethernet frames; the attacker sends a crafted Ethernet frame.

Risk Assessment

Organizations using Cisco ISR G2 routers with vulnerable Cisco IOS may experience unexpected device reloads and network connectivity disruptions.

Recommendation

Upgrade Cisco IOS to a release containing the fix for CSCvc03809 or apply Cisco-recommended workarounds.

Original NVD description (English source)

A vulnerability in the implementation of a protocol in Cisco Integrated Services Routers Generation 2 (ISR G2) Routers running Cisco IOS 15.0 through 15.6 could allow an unauthenticated, adjacent attacker to cause an affected device to reload, resulting in a denial of service (DoS) condition. The vulnerability is due to a misclassification of Ethernet frames.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by sending a crafted Ethernet frame to an affected device.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to cause the affected device to reload, resulting in a DoS condition. Cisco Bug IDs: CSCvc03809.
